Delivery Hospital

NorthBay Medical Center (Fairfield)

Over 60 years of service with 1,000+ births per year. Solano County's only Level III NICU with approximately 180 NICU admissions annually. Solano County's only Baby-Friendly designated hospital. Spacious private birthing suites, a dedicated neonatal transport team serving surrounding hospitals, and the highest level of neonatal intensive care available in the region.

California Legal Framework

Pre-birth parentage orders mean both parents are on the birth certificate before the baby is born, regardless of marital status or genetic connection. No post-birth adoption. No waiting period. No uncertainty.

For surrogacy births involving multiples or preterm delivery risk, having a Level III NICU at the delivery hospital rather than requiring a transfer is a significant advantage. Learn more about California surrogacy laws.

If you're a woman in Fairfield or Solano County thinking about surrogacy, you're weighing whether it's meaningful enough to give your body and your time, and whether the financial side reflects what the commitment actually requires. We don't ask you to choose between those things. Both matter.

Surrogacy is one of the most significant things a woman can do for another family. It is also one of the most tangible paths to financial stability for women who qualify. At MUSA, we hold both of those truths simultaneously, because the surrogates in our program do too.

Surrogate compensation: $65,000–$90,000+. First-time surrogates start at $65,000+ base. Experienced surrogates start at $70,000+. Total compensation, including monthly allowances, milestone payments, and full coverage of pregnancy-related expenses, reaches $90,000 or more depending on your situation.

Investment

Fairfield Surrogacy Costs

Total surrogacy investment typically starts at $160,000+, covering surrogate compensation, agency fees, IVF and medical expenses, legal fees, and insurance. Fairfield's position between Sacramento and the Bay Area means intended parents can choose from fertility clinics across both corridors, which can affect the medical portion of the budget.

California's clear legal framework also simplifies the legal portion of the process. Pre-birth parentage orders mean no post-birth adoption proceedings, which can reduce legal costs compared to states with less established surrogacy law. For a full breakdown, visit our detailed cost guide.

How do I become a surrogate in Fairfield, California?

Start with an application that takes about 10 minutes. Requirements include being 21–40 years old, having carried at least one pregnancy to term, having a healthy pregnancy history, being a non-smoker, and having a stable living situation. See our full surrogate requirements.

How much does surrogacy cost in Fairfield?

Total surrogacy costs typically start at $160,000 and can exceed $200,000 depending on medical needs, insurance, and other factors. See our full full cost breakdown.

What makes NorthBay Medical Center a good hospital for surrogacy births?

NorthBay Medical Center is Solano County’s only hospital with a Level III NICU, the highest level of neonatal intensive care. It is also the county’s only Baby-Friendly designated hospital, with over 60 years of service, more than 1,000 births per year, approximately 180 NICU admissions annually, spacious private birthing suites, and a neonatal transport team that serves surrounding hospitals. For surrogacy births, having this level of neonatal infrastructure at the delivery hospital eliminates the need for transfers if the baby requires specialized care.
